There's been no more eagerly awaited hotel opening in recent times than the revamp of the
classic
HotelEspaña
asafour-star-plus.The
modernista
iconhasbeensumptuouslyrestored,
and the gem-like interior - colourful tiles, bright mosaics, sculpted marble, iron swirls and
marine motifs - has no equal in Barcelona. While public areas reboot the
modernista
era,
guest rooms are a perfectly judged boutique blend of earth tones and designer style, with
rain-showers, iPod docks and the like. There's a plunge pool and chill-out deck on the roof
terrace, while the handsome house restaurant - known as
Fond
aEspaña
- offers contempor-
ary Catalan bistro dishes by hot chef Martín Berasategui.
€198

Hotel Peninsular
c/de Sant Pau 34 933 023 138,
hotelpeninsular.net
; Liceu;
map
.
This interesting old building originally belonged to a priestly order, which explains the
slightly cell-like quality of the rooms. However, there's nothing spartan about the galleried
inner courtyard (around which the rooms are ranged), hung
wit
h dozens of tumbling house-
plants, while breakfast is served in the arcaded dining room.
€80
Hotel Sant Agustí
Pl. Sant Agusti 3 933 181 658,
hotelsa.com
;
Liceu;
map
.
Bar-
celona'soldest hotel occupies a former seventeenth-century convent building, with balconies
overlooking a restored square and church. It's of thre
e-sta
r standard, with the best rooms loc-
ated in the attic, from where there are rooftop views.
€110
Market Hotel
c/del Comte Borrell 68, at Ptge. Sant Antoni Abat 933 251 205,
mar-
kethotel.com.es
;
Sant Antoni;
map
.
The designer-budget
Market
makes a definite splash
with its part-Japanese, part neo-colonial look - think jet-black rooms with hardwood floors
and shutters, and boxy wardrobes topped with travel trunks. It's a feel that flows through the
buildinganddownintotheimpressiverestaurant,wherethefoodisexceptionallygoodvalue,
whil
e the hotel's vintage Asian-style
Bar Rosso
has become a bit of a local hipsters' haunt.
€100
